Strength Through Survival Unveiling Planned
Honoring women who have overcome incredible obstacles in their battle against breast cancer will be the focus of two events this fall. The events are sponsored by Rose Norton, a local photographer, through her Portraits of Distinction Series. Titled: Strength Through Survival this exhibit is a collection of up to 50 photographs of local breast cancer survivors.
The events are designed to provide inspiration during Breast Cancer Awareness Month in October, and will include:
Strength Through Survival Preview Party
This event includes the premier exhibition unveiling and will be held Wednesday, October 3, from 4 to 7 p.m., at the Thomas Edison Inn, Ivy Room. There is no charge for admission.
High Tea & Fashion Show
This exciting event will feature a tea and fashion show by Macy’s and Catherine’s. The event will be held Sunday, October 21, at Fore Lakes Golf Club. Tickets are sold in advance for this event and are $20/person or $175 for a table of 10. Ticket-holders are invited to bring a platter of sweets to share as well as table settings and their favorite tea service. In addition to raffle drawings and the fashion show, prizes will be awarded to the table that best represents a theme.
“October is the perfect time to showcase the women in our community who have overcome breast cancer,” comments Rose Norton. “Their survival is truly inspirational providing encouragement to other women.”

Funds raised from these events will benefit the Mercy Hospital Pink Ribbon Fund, which provides financial assistance to women in our community who lack health insurance and are in need of advanced breast cancer diagnosis. |
